About Carolyn Farrell
Carolyn Farrell is a scholar working on Neurology, Pathology and Forensic Medicine and Radiological and Ultrasound Technology, having authored 8 papers that have together received 100 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Genetic factors in colorectal cancer (4 papers), DNA Repair Mechanisms (3 papers) and BRCA gene mutations in cancer (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Sensory Systems (11 citations), Neurology (18 citations) and Reproductive Medicine (16 citations). Carolyn Farrell has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Ireland. Frequent co-authors include Kerry J. Rodabaugh, Mollie L. Hutton, Paulette Mhawech‐Fauceglia, M. Steven Piver, Richard A. DiCioccio, P. C. Gaskell, Jeffery M. Vance, Chantelle M. Wolpert, Martin C. Mahoney and Joseph E. Bauer. Their work appears in journals such as Cancer, Obstetrics and Gynecology and BMJ Open.
